WaitlistBasketball: Boys & Girls, Gr. 2-3BasketballGrades 2 & 3Coaches Goudy & Flick Calling all 2nd and 3rd graders interested in honing their basketball skills and experiencing friendly competition with their DC friends! This program is designed to develop their basketball skills while being introduced to competitive play in a fun, supportive environment. Each session emphasizes skill development, team concepts, and competing in 3-on-3 games which will provide valuable game experience. The 3-on-3 format offers more ball touches, involvement, and decision-making opportunities than traditional 5-on-5, making it an ideal transition from the foundational skills taught in K–1 basketball and the structure and intensity of travel basketball in 4th grade. Building a Festive Mediterranean Mezze / Charcuterie BoardCulinaryThe word “Mezze” refers to what we all know as finger foods and dips. Many Mediterranean meals consist of a variety of “mezze” items that come together creating the most wonderful flavors, tastes and textures. Learn how to bring warmth, color, and the flavors of the Mediterranean to your fall and winter gatherings with this festive Mediterranean mezze cook-along class where Chef Tess (a descendant of Spartans) will guide you through creating a stunning mezze-style charcuterie board, perfect for sharing or seasonal entertaining any time of year. The mezze-style charcuterie board will include four delicious scratch-made dips, warm-spiced, bright Greek meatballs, and handmade pita bread. Mezze boards / platters will be rounded out with an array of fresh and pickled vegetables, olives, fruit and nuts for a vibrant crowd—pleasing spread! The board, platter, or table becomes the canvas upon which we create an edible work of art! Equipment: A food processor or blender is needed for the creation of the Whipped feta. NewBulgogi Kimbap: Korean Signature Rice RollsCulinaryKimbap is Korea’s answer to the perfect rice roll—similar in shape to sushi, yet uniquely its own with savory cooked fillings that create distinctive flavors and textures. Join Tess for this fun-filled cook-along adventure and explore the art of making Bulgogi Kimbap rolls from start to finish, rivaling any you wild find in a restaurant. From seasoning the rice, to marinating and cooking Bulgogi, preparing colorful vegetables (including a quick pickle), and crafting a delicate omelet, you'll bring everything together into beautiful hand-rolled Kimbap. Along the way, you will discover the key difference between sushi and Kimbap, practice rolling and shaping techniques and enjoy the bold, balanced flavors of your creation.
